Can you author a Collector map to edit attributes only, not location?

I want to be able to give editing access of the fields in Collector but not allow users to move the location of a point. Is there a way to lock the location so that the users cannot move the point or line, but allows them to still edit the attribute data? Thanks!

Hi Brian-

You can configure the service to only allow users to update the attribute information; this will be respected within Collector.  You'll want to update the setting below on the Item Details page of your service.

Thanks for your help. That solves the problem which is great, but I noticed once you choose 'only update feature attributes' you can no longer add a new point. In my situation it would be ideal if the person in the field could edit the attributes and add a new point, but not be able to move the physical location of the point once it is collected. Is there a setting for that as well? Thanks!

Brian-

No such setting exists, though you could limit them to only editing features that they have created.  One consideration is that you'd probably want to allow the field worker would be able to correct a mistake made during collection, which would not be possible in the desired scenario you described.

Hi Gus-

The settings above are accessed from the item details page of the feature service, and clicking the Settings tab  beneath the name of the service. You will need to be the owner of the item in order to do this (or an admin).
